In Ayurveda, the colon is the seat of Vata dosha, the intelligence that governs the nervous system, movement, and the body's natural downward-moving elimination functions. When the colon is well-supported, strong, and clean, Apana Vata (the specific downward-moving energy that governs elimination, reproductive function, and the lower body's intelligence) flows freely. All major natural elimination channels ultimately lead through and exit via the colon. When the colon is weakened, congested, or sluggish, everything upstream may feel the effect: the liver, the blood, the skin, the nervous system, and the entire digestive tract.

  • Building Gradually: If you are new to Psyllium Husk or Slippery Elm, begin with 1 teaspoon daily and gradually increase over 1–2 weeks as your digestive system adapts.

  • Long-Term Daily Use: Apana Prana is specifically formulated for consistent long-term use. Regular daily use helps progressively support healthy bowel function, a naturally balanced digestive environment, and comfortable digestive wellness over time.

  • Taking With Medications and Supplements: Because the natural fibres in this formula may slow the absorption of oral medications and some supplements, allow at least 1–2 hours between Apana Prana and any medications or supplements. What is the difference between Apana Prana and Triphala? +

Both Triphala and Apana Prana draw on Ayurvedic principles to support comfortable digestion and natural elimination, but they have different qualities. Triphala is a classical three-fruit formula with a gently cleansing, slightly drying nature. Apana Prana was
formulated by Kimmana Nichols using herbs traditionally valued in Ayurveda together with Slippery Elm to create a more moistening, lubricating and soothing formula, emphasising Picchila (Ayurveda's nourishing, mucilage-rich quality). An Ayurvedic practitioner can help determine which formula best suits your individual constitution and current state of balance.
